Q-omics provides the consensus-scored LINC01943 profile across patient tissues and cancer cell-line models. LINC01943 expression is associated with patient survival in 25 of 34 cancer types, with the highest sampling consensus in SKCM. Among the 18 cancer types available for tumor–normal comparison, LINC01943 is differentially expressed in 13, with the highest sampling consensus in KIRC. Additionally, LINC01943 RNA expression shows 18,706 significant protein co-abundance associations, with the highest sampling consensus in LSCC. Together, these results highlight SKCM, KIRC, and LSCC as cancer lineages where LINC01943 shows reproducible signals across survival, tumor–normal expression, and patient cross-omics analyses.

Every result is evaluated using two consensus scores. Sampling consensus measures how consistently a finding is reproduced within a cancer lineage across different conditions. Lineage consensus measures how broadly the result is shared across cancer types, distinguishing pan-cancer signals from lineage-specific patterns.

This table ranks reproducible LINC01943 RNA expression–survival associations across cancer types. High LINC01943 expression shows unfavorable associations in KIRP, UVM and KIRC, but favorable associations in SKCM, HNSC and CESC. The SKCM Kaplan–Meier curve shows clear separation, with the low-expression group declining faster, consistent with the favorable association (log-rank p < 0.001). Together, the overview and detailed table identify SKCM as the clearest survival context for LINC01943 RNA expression.

This table ranks reproducible tumor–normal expression differences for LINC01943. A negative fold-change indicates higher expression in normal tissue than in tumor tissue. LINC01943 shows higher tumor expression in KIRC, HNSC, COAD, LIHC, STAD and LUAD. The KIRC box plot shows higher LINC01943 RNA expression in tumor versus normal tissue (log2 FC = +1.369, t-test p < 0.001).
